PETITIO'i FOR Li.AYE 10 IMTEil'~"!E On February 10, 1071, the Atomic Energy Commission (the Commission) published in the Federal Renister a Notice of Proposed Changes to Technical Specifications of Facility Operating License with respect to Northern States Powcr Company's (Applicant) Monticello Nuclear Generating Plant (39 F.R. 5520).
The proposed change in the technical specifications of Provisional Operating License No. DPR-22, would permit the use of a partial laoding of S x S fuel (containing U-235), including a fuel assembly containing segmented test rods, and also would authorize changes to the limiting conditions for operations associated with fuel densification for the S x 8 and 7 x 7 fuels.
